Navigating Workers’ Compensation in California

Workers’ compensation is meant to be a form of protection for employees hurt on the job — but in many cases, the process turns into a complex web of paperwork, pushback, and delays. In California, the workers’ comp system is governed by strict laws that can be difficult to navigate without professional assistance. Eligible workers may qualify for treatment benefits, temporary disability benefits, compensation for permanent injury, and even job retraining.

However, many workers are surprised to learn what can be excluded or how fast objections can arise. Employers may claim your injury occurred off the clock or that you missed reporting deadlines. If Workers’ Compensation Doesn’t Cover Everything in Alhambra

While workers’ compensation can handle many injuries, it often fails to provide complete recovery, especially if your injury leads to long-term disability or affects your ability to return to your previous job. What many people don’t realize is that they may also have the option to file a separate legal action in addition to their workers’ comp coverage.

A third-party claim can be pursued if your injury was caused by someone other than your employer, such as:

A subcontractor or vendor on a shared worksite
A negligent property owner or general contractor
A manufacturer of faulty equipment or tools
A careless driver who caused an accident while you were on the job

Getting Hurt on a Construction Job in Alhambra

Construction zones are some of the most hazardous workplaces in Alhambra. With powerful tools, hazardous materials, and work done at great heights, the risk of life-altering accidents is constant. In fact, the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) reports that a fifth of worker deaths occur in the construction industry. The leading causes — known as the “Fatal Four” — are slips and falls, impact from equipment, electrocution, and being crushed or trapped.
These injuries often involve multiple parties — including site managers, property owners, and third-party contractors — and require a seasoned legal team to sort through the liability.

The Importance of Medical Documentation in Supporting Your Claim

Proper medical records is the foundation of any successful workers’ compensation claim. Comprehensive notes not only validate the extent of your injuries but also create a direct connection between the employment-related event and your medical condition. Key forms of evidence include:
Initial Medical Reports

Immediate assessments post-injury.

Diagnostic Test Results

X-rays, MRIs, and other relevant tests.

Treatment Records

Documentation of ongoing treatments and therapies.

Physician Statements

Professional opinions on your injury's impact on your work capabilities.

Ensuring that all medical evidence is comprehensive and accurately reflects your condition can significantly bolster your claim.

Getting Back to Work After a Work Accident in Alhambra

Getting through a job-related accident involves more than just restoring your health; it also includes navigating the transition back to work. In California, employers are expected to provide alternate tasks or roles to assist injured employees during their recovery period. This approach not only facilitates a faster return to work but also helps protect earnings and professional identity.
